The region around Friedrichroda offers several popular huts. The Great Inselsberg is a notable summit with expansive views and facilities. Another popular spot is Großer Dreiherrenstein on the Rennsteig, a historic site offering cuisine and service directly on the famous long-distance hiking trail. The Brotteröder Hut is also a well-regarded rest stop before ascending the Great Inselsberg.
For breathtaking panoramic views, consider visiting the Great Inselsberg, which provides expansive vistas of the Thuringian countryside. The Neue Gehlberger Hütte, perched on the 978-meter-high Schneekopf, also boasts a large sun terrace with panoramic views across the Thuringian Forest. Additionally, the Ruppberghütte on the Ruppberg is known for its unique panoramic view after the ascent.

The huts in the region typically offer hearty, traditional cuisine. For example, the Waldschänke Dreiherrnstein is known for its "good bourgeois cuisine" featuring homemade dishes and game. The Neue Gehlberger Hütte serves classic dishes like roulades, schnitzel, and goulash, often with seasonal, regional ingredients. Many huts, like the Ruppberghütte, also provide "hearty delicacies" and often have a convivial atmosphere.
Yes, the region is rich in history. The Großer Dreiherrenstein on the Rennsteig is a significant man-made monument and historical site, marking former borders. The Waldschänke Dreiherrnstein also has roots tracing back to 1911, offering a sense of history with its traditional guesthouse atmosphere.
The huts are excellent starting or stopping points for various hikes. The Rennsteig, Germany's oldest long-distance hiking trail, passes by several huts like the Waldschänke Dreiherrnstein and the Neue Gehlberger Hütte. You can find numerous hiking routes, including easy options like the Reinhard's Spring – Benedictine Trail loop or the AHORN Mountain Hotel Friedrichroda – Bocksprung Trail loop.
Absolutely. For beginners or families, there are several easy hiking routes around Friedrichroda. Examples include the Reinhard's Spring – Benedictine Trail loop (6.6 km) and the AHORN Mountain Hotel Friedrichroda – Bocksprung Trail loop (3.9 km). These trails offer accessible ways to enjoy the natural beauty and reach some of the huts.
The huts around Friedrichroda can be enjoyed year-round. During warmer months, many huts, like the Waldschänke Dreiherrnstein, offer beer gardens for outdoor relaxation. The Ruppberghütte is typically open on weekends during summer. In winter, huts like the Neue Gehlberger Hütte provide a cozy ambiance with fireplaces, catering to skiers and winter hikers. The Ebertswiese Mountain Meadow is particularly enchanting with its flora in spring and summer.

The Ebertswiese Mountain Meadow is a natural monument celebrated for its enchanting flora and as an ideal spot for rest and relaxation. It features a beautiful mountain lake, making it a picturesque location to unwind and enjoy nature.
Several huts serve as excellent rest stops. The Waldschänke Dreiherrnstein is directly on the Rennsteig, making it a convenient break point for hikers. The Großer Dreiherrenstein on the Rennsteig also offers good opportunities to stop by with cuisine and service. Additionally, the Brotteröder Hut provides a solid shelter and a good place to rest, especially before the ascent to the Großer Inselsberg.
Yes, you can find shelters along the trails. For instance, the "Five-armed signpost" with shelter is located at 640m above sea level and provides a refuge where you can orient yourself and take a break.
Yes, the Neue Gehlberger Hütte, located on the Schneekopf, functions as a hiking hostel and provides multi-bed rooms for overnight stays. It also features modern sanitary facilities, catering to hikers, cyclists, and skiers looking for rustic accommodation in the Thuringian Forest.
